About the episode

Jon Rothstein is joined by Arizona head coach Tommy Lloyd to talk about his favorite vacation spots, the decision to leave Gonzaga for Arizona, the importance of rivalry games and more. They also get into freshman Koa Peat, the importance of having veteran players and what it's going to take for Arizona to make a deep NCAA tournament run.
